Gtk button tutorial
WebHere's an example of using gtk_button_new to create a button with a picture and a label in it. I've broken up the code to create a box from the rest so you can use it in your … WebLayout Containers — Python GTK+ 3 Tutorial 3.4 documentation. 6. Layout Containers ¶. While many GUI toolkits require you to precisely place widgets in a window, using absolute positioning, GTK+ uses a different approach. …
Gtk button tutorial
Did you know?
WebMar 28, 2024 · If you want to display a button with only an image inside it, you can use: GtkWidget *image = gtk_image_new_from_file ("..."); GtkWidget *button = gtk_button_new (); gtk_button_set_image (GTK_BUTTON (button), image); On the other hand, if you want to have a button with both text and an image inside it, you can use: WebThe gtk.Button widget is generally used to trigger a callback function that is called when the button is pressed. The various signals and how to use them are outlined below. The …
Webgtkmm is the official C++ interface for GTK. Highlights include typesafe callbacks, and a comprehensive set of widgets that are easily extensible via inheritance. You can create … WebGTK is event-driven. The toolkit listens for events such as a click on a button, and passes the event to your application. This chapter contains some tutorial information to get you started with GTK programming. It …
WebMake sure the button is set up correctly: Create a new Gtk.Button object. Create a new Gtk.Image object, passing the fully qualified name of the image resource to the constructor. Set the Image property of the button to the Gtk.Image object. Add the button to your Winforms container, like any other control. Here's some sample code to demonstrate: WebThe easiest way to install GTK3 for Python is by using PyGObject for Windows. It offers an installer that installs most things you need to develop GTK appilcations. The number of options the PyGObject installer offers can be daunting, but for most GTK projects the only option you have to select is GTK+ 3.xx . C++
Webgtk의 유파를 따르다나는 발톱을 만들러 간다. 인터넷에서 glide 화면의 메뉴를 비유하면 HTML/BODY는 맨 윗층(≈ 창)이고 사용자 조작을 동반하는 버튼과 텍스트 필드는 Control(Button, Entry 등), 탭과 이미지는 Display, div는 용기(GtkBox 등)이다.
WebAdd a button! One of the most basic widgets is a Button. Let's make one and add it to the layout. self. button = Gtk. Button ( label="Hello" ) self. box1. append ( self. button) Now … schatz accounting st marys paWebGTK is event-driven. The toolkit listens for events such as a click on a button, and passes the event to your application. This chapter contains some tutorial information to get you … schatzalp snow \u0026 mountain resortWebGTK and Python About PyGObject is a Python package which provides bindings for GObject based libraries such as GTK, GStreamer, WebKitGTK, GLib, GIO and many more. It supports Linux, Windows and macOS and works with Python 2.7+, Python 3.5+, PyPy and PyPy3. PyGObject, including this documentation, is licensed under the LGPLv2.1+. schatzalp thurgauWebAs seen above, example-1.c builds further upon example-0.c by adding a button to our window, with the label "Hello World". Two new GtkWidget pointers are declared to accomplish this, button and button_box.The button_box variable is created to store a GtkButtonBox which is GTK+'s way of controlling the size and layout of buttons. The … schatzalp snow \\u0026 mountain resortWebJan 6, 2024 · GTK+ tutorial. This is a GTK+ programming tutorial. In this tutorial, we will learn the basics of GUI programming in GTK+ and C language. The GTK+ tutorial is suitable for beginners and intermediate programmers. This tutorial covers GTK+ 2. schatz 49 400 day clock suspension springWebJan 6, 2024 · In this tutorial, we will learn the basics of GUI programming in GTK+ and C language. The GTK+ tutorial is suitable for beginners and intermediate programmers. … schatzalp swiss historic hotelWebMar 27, 2024 · If you want to display a button with only an image inside it, you can use: GtkWidget *image = gtk_image_new_from_file ("..."); GtkWidget *button = … schatz and associates